The Stop Killing Games movement faces an EU complaint questioning the founder's disclosure of voluntary contributions amid a successful petition drive.
The Stop Killing Games campaign has achieved significant momentum, accumulating over 1.4 million signatures, paving the way for new legislative discussions in the European Commission.
Ubisoft's CEO commented on the ongoing Stop Killing Games campaign, emphasizing the company's dedication to game support while acknowledging the limitations associated with game services.
Nicolae Ștefănuță, an EU Parliament Vice President, has endorsed the 'Stop Killing Games' initiative, emphasizing that once a game is sold, it should belong to the customer.
The movement to preserve online multiplayer games receives endorsement from European Parliament Vice President Nicolae Stefanuta.
Former Blizzard developer Jason Hall explains his opposition to the Stop Killing Games petition.
The Video Games Europe association opposes the Stop Killing Games movement as it approaches a significant EU milestone.
The Stop Killing Games initiative has successfully gathered enough signatures but faces potential issues of fraudulent entries.
The leader of the 'Stop Killing Games' initiative, Ross Scott, has expressed his weariness as the petition deadline looms, criticizing companies for normalizing the removal of purchased games.
Yves Guillemot addresses the ongoing petition promoting support for older games amid criticism and campaign developments.
A group of European publishers expresses concerns that the Stop Killing Games initiative could limit choices for developers.
The Stop Killing Games movement has launched a petition tracker amid rising concerns over game accessibility.
Pirate Software reveals he has been swatted and received numerous death threats amid criticism over his comments on the Stop Killing Games initiative.
